| NASB © | Hebrew | Transliteration | Strong's | Definition | Origin | | You, O LORD | יְהוָֽה־ | Yah·weh | 3068 | the proper name of the God of Israel | from havah |
| God | אֱלֹהִ֥ים | e·lo·him | 430 | God, god | pl. of eloah |
| of hosts, | צְבָאֹ֡ות | tze·va·'o·vt | 6635 | army, war, warfare | from tsaba |
| the God | אֱלֹ֘הֵ֤י | e·lo·hei | 430 | God, god | pl. of eloah |
| of Israel, | יִשְׂרָאֵ֗ל | yis·ra·'el | 3478 | "God strives," another name of Jacob and his desc. | from sarah and el |
| Awake | | | 7019a | to awake | a prim. root |
| to punish | לִפְקֹ֥ד | lif·kod | 6485 | to attend to, visit, muster, appoint | a prim. root |
| all | כָּֽל־ | kol- | 3605 | the whole, all | from kalal |
| the nations; | הַגֹּויִ֑ם | hag·go·v·yim; | 1471 | nation, people | from the same as gav |
| Do not be gracious | תָּחֹ֨ן | ta·chon | 2603a | to show favor, be gracious | a prim. root |
| to any | כָּל־ | kol- | 3605 | the whole, all | from kalal |
| [who are] treacherous | בֹּ֖גְדֵי | bo·ge·dei | 898 | to act or deal treacherously | a prim. root |
| in iniquity. | אָ֣וֶן | a·ven | 205 | trouble, sorrow, wickedness | from an unused word |
| Selah. | סֶֽלָה׃ | se·lah. | 5542 | to lift up, exalt | from salal |

Selah.King James Bible Thou therefore, O LORD God of hosts, the God of Israel, awake to visit all the heathen: be not merciful to any wicked transgressors. Selah. American King James Version You therefore, O LORD God of hosts, the God of Israel, awake to visit all the heathen: be not merciful to any wicked transgressors. Selah. American Standard Version Even thou, O Jehovah God of hosts, the God of Israel, Arise to visit all the nations: Be not merciful to any wicked transgressors. Selah Darby Bible Translation Yea, do thou, Jehovah, the God of hosts, the God of Israel, arise to visit all the nations: be not gracious to any plotters of iniquity. Selah. English Revised Version Even thou, O LORD God of hosts, the God of Israel, arise to visit all the heathen: be not merciful to any wicked transgressors. Selah Webster's Bible Translation Thou therefore, O LORD God of hosts, the God of Israel, awake to visit all the heathen: be not merciful to any wicked transgressors. Selah. World English Bible You, Yahweh God of Armies, the God of Israel, rouse yourself to punish the nations. Show no mercy to the wicked traitors. Selah. Young's Literal Translation And Thou, Jehovah, God of Hosts, God of Israel, Awake to inspect all the nations. Favour not any treacherous dealers of iniquity. Selah.
